Case Manager (Ellington)
$45,000–$47,000 year
On-site · New York City, New York, United States
Job Summary
Case Manager role in Ellington providing direct case management, intake assessment, counseling, crisis intervention, advocacy, and referrals to help relocate families into permanent housing. Responsibilities include documenting in CARES/DHS systems, coordinating services, developing service plans, facilitating group activities, and ensuring compliance with state/city regulations. Requires building protective relationships with families, coordinating resources, strong written/verbal communication, bilingual ability desirable, and willingness to travel within the New York City area. Shift includes long hours and a Tuesday–Saturday schedule; office-based with on-call one-week quarterly. Minimum qualifications emphasize a Bachelor’s or Associate degree in social services fields and experience in social services, housing, or crisis intervention; proficiency with Microsoft Office and strong interpersonal skills.
